York councillor's nitrous oxide warning
Cllr Andrew Waller tells Tamzin Kraftman why he wants more awareness of the dangers of nitrous oxide. Now categorised as a class C drug, possession of laughing gas for its "psychoactive effects" will carry a sentence of up to two years in prison. The government says the ban will combat anti-social behaviour and reduce damage to users' health.
